Haddonfield Japan Exchange resumes

Applications are accepted until Dec. 31.

The Haddonfield Japan Exchange is ready to resume after several years of postponements due to the COVID virus.

This summer Haddonfield students will be visiting, Sendai Ikuei Gakuen, one of the most prestigious high schools in Japan. For about two weeks the Haddonfield students will be living with Japanese host families, whose values are basically the same as families here in Haddonfield. The language and customs may be different, but there are more similarities than differences.

Applications are still being accepted until Dec. 31. If you are selected to join those who have already been selected, you will be required to attend classes on Japanese customs, culture, and the Japanese language on a regular basis, beginning in January 2023.

The total cost of this trip is the cost of the airfare, which is yet to be determined, plus some small expenses for group gifts, etc.

The trip will be chaperoned by two local adults during the travel times as well as on the daily trips provided by Sendai Ikuei Gakuen High School, at other times you will be with your Japanese host families who will also provide local family activities.
